Telling the whole truth about yourself in a job interview may mean losing a position to a better-qualified candidate. But the alternative -- lying about your degree, qualifications, or experience for short-term gain -- inevitably will come back to haunt you.
在面试中,对自己所有的情况都实话实说可能就意味着会输给一个更适合该职位的候选者,但是另一方面,如果对自己的学位,资历,经验捏造事实,即使可以得到工作一段时间,最后也不可避免的会伤害到你自己。
Still, there are gray areas in which a small fib -- or embellishment -- could go a long way toward helping you land a job.
但是,修饰下一些细节方面的灰色地带仍可以在很大程度上帮你得到一份工作。
"I’m a pro-fibber," says blogger and consultant Nicole Williams, author of the forthcoming book "Girl on Top: Your Guide to Turning Dating Rules into Career Success." "At the same time, you have to be aware of the risks and do it very strategically."
即将出版的书籍"Girl on Top: Your Guide to Turning Dating Rules into Career Success."一书的作者,博主,顾问Nicole Williams说:"我是一个说谎专家,但在说谎的同时,你要明白这样做的风险,要非常有战略性地去说谎。"
Here are six areas in which you can enhance your credentials without having a Pinocchio moment during an interview -- or even worse, after you’ve gotten the job.
